Table 3.

Reasons Not to Take an HIV Test Among Participants Who Did Not Obtained an HIV Test in the Past Year (n= 60)a

Reason n (%)
I'm afraid I might be HIV positive 27 (46)
I have been tested for HIV 21 (36)
I'm afraid my results might be reported to the government 20 (34)
I'm afraid people might treat me differently 19 (32)
I have been practicing safe sex 16 (27)
I don't have the time 10 (17)
I know my partners don't have HIV 7 (12)
I'm afraid people will think I'm gay 6 (10)
I can't get to test site 4 (7)
I can't afford it 3 (5)
I don't know where to get tested 3 (5)
I am not at risk for HIV 2 (3)
It is not important 0
My doctor never recommended I get an HIV test 0
Other reason 5 (8)
a

Reasons are not mutually-exclusive (i.e., participants chose all that applied).
